Potato and pancetta bake

Hot, creamy and utterly delicious, this hearty potato and pancetta bake is beautiful enjoyed straight out of the oven for a tasty family dinner or wonderful side.

Method

1.Preheat oven to 200°C. Grease a 2-litre (8-cup) ovenproof dish.
2.Heat oil in a medium frying pan over medium heat; cook onion and pancetta, stirring, until onion softens and pancetta is crisp
3.Combine cream, sour cream and chives in a jug.
4.Layer a third of the potato slices over base of the dish; sprinkle with half the pancetta mixture. Pour a third of the cream mixture over pancetta mixture; sprinkle with a third of the cheese. Repeat layering, finishing with cheese.
5.Bake 40 minutes or until browned. Stand 10 minutes before serving.
